GERMANY, Harz, silver Baptism thaler, 1711, (28.95 g), (Davenport 2935). Slight flan flaw, otherwise toned, good very fine.

Ex Dr V.J.A.Flynn Collection and previously Status International Sale 315 (lot 6896).
